Help Content from Code

Turn any codebase into help articles your AI agent can use

A Claude Code skill that reads your codebase and writes a complete help center — no templates, no manual work. It analyzes routes, components, config schemas, and error messages to build a content plan, then writes professional articles optimized for AI agent retrieval. Every claim traces back to actual source code. Articles are structured so tools like Intercom’s Fin, Zendesk AI, or any RAG system can retrieve and use them accurately. Plain markdown output — import anywhere, no vendor lock-in.

I built this to solve a specific problem: you’re a startup, you want to set up an AI support agent, but it needs a knowledge base — and you don’t have one. Writing help articles from scratch takes weeks, and you’ve got a hundred other things to ship. But the answers already exist in your codebase. Every feature, config option, and error message is already defined in code. The missing step was extracting that into articles structured for how AI agents actually retrieve and use information. Help Content from Code is a Claude Code skill that does exactly that. Point it at your project and it generates a full set of help articles — grounded in source code, optimized for RAG retrieval, ready to import into Fin or any other customer support AI Agent. Some examples from the demo site: - Ollama → 13 articles, 18,637 words - QMD → 8 articles, 16,064 words - Pearcleaner → 12 articles, 17,358 words Install with `npx skills add gustavscirulis/help-content-from-code`, open any repo, and ask it to write help articles. Also works with GitHub Copilot, Cursor, and Gemini CLI. Would love to see what you generate with it!

A “hunter” on Product Hunt is the community member who submits a product to the platform — uploading the images, the link, and tagging the makers behind it. Hunters typically write the first comment explaining why a product is worth attention, and their followers are notified the moment they post. Around 79% of featured launches on Product Hunt are self-hunted by their makers, but a well-known hunter still acts as a signal of quality to the rest of the community.
